Experimental and theoretical studies of fatigue of steel fibre reinforced concrete under low-cycle compression

Abstract

The results of theoretical studies of steel fibre-reinforced concrete fatigue under low-cycle compression are presented. Analytical dependencies for its determination are established. The method of experimental studies of steel fibre-reinforced concrete prisms under low-cycle compression is presented. Experimental studies of steel fibre-reinforced concrete fatigue under low-cycle compression have been carried out. It is established that the relative low-cycle compression fatigue for steel fibre-reinforced concrete can be taken at 0.75.
